Director Reveals Rushed Release Hampered 'The Callisto Protocol'
Glen Schofield cites publisher Krafton's insistence on an early launch, leading to cut content and development challenges.
- Schofield claims he was promised more time but was later forced to meet an earlier deadline.
- Significant content, including bosses and enemy types, was cut due to the accelerated timeline.
- The Covid-19 pandemic and the 'Great Resignation' further strained development resources.
- Schofield reflects on the difficulties and suggests a sequel should be made to fulfill the original vision.
- Striking Distance Studios laid off over 30 developers after the game's final DLC release.
